Template Management in CloudStack

My first template• Existing VM or appliance

• Need to have HTTP server

• Set secstorage.allowed.internal.sites if private cloud

Creation options• Register template in UI

• Templates Register Template

• Upload using registerTemplate API

• http://cloudstack.apache.org/docs/api/apidocs-4.5/user/registerTemplate.html

• Clone from CloudStack instance

• Stop instance View Volumes Create Template

Key Template Attributes

Obvious• Hypervisor

• Operating system type

• Zone

Not so obvious• IsDynamicallyScalable Hypervisor tools

• PasswordEnabledCloudStack sets root pwd

• SSHKeyEnabled Can post configure

• RequiresHVM Defines virtualization mode

VM Password and SSH Key Management Challenges

Obtain information from VR• VR is obtained from leases

• Scripts use wget

• Assumes sysinit not systemd

What to fix – varies by OS?• CentOS 7 defaults to curl not wget

• CentOS 7 is systemd need unit files

• CentOS 7 may use NetworkManager

Core Packer Concepts

Builder• Responsible for creation of VM image

• Connects to virtual infrastructure

• Default supports vSphere, OpenStack, AMI, VirtualBox, QEMU, Docker

• No XenServer needed to fix that ;)

Provisioner• Runs post-build activities

Post-Processor• Takes VM image artifact and transforms it

• In our case upload to CloudStack needed to fix that too ;)

Key activities occurring during template build from ISO

1. Download ISO into ISO SR (if not already present)

2. Attach ISO to VM object and boot

3. Instruct installer to user kickstart file

4. Installer does its thing and shuts VM down

5. Upon shutdown, swap installer ISO for XenServer tools ISO

6. Install ISO and shutdown

7. Detect shutdown and run Provisioners

8. Export and import into CloudStack as template

xenserver-iso Builder

Creates a new XenServer image from an ISO

Key parameters• Host connection

• ISO location

• Boot commands

Artifact output type• xva, vdi_raw, vhd, vhd_raw

Known limitations• Linux only (uses SSH)

• Requires NFS shared storage

xenserver-vm builder

Creates a new XenServer image from existing running VM

Key parameters• Host connection

• VM name

• Cleanse command

• Cleanse scripts

Artifact output type• xva, vdi_raw, vhd, vhd_raw

Known limitations• Linux only (uses SSH)

• Requires NFS shared storage

cloudstack-xenserver post-processor

Creates a new CloudStack template from xenserver builders

Key parameters• CloudStack API keys

• Zone, OS type

• Script configuration

Artifact input • xenserver-iso, xenserver-vm

Key activities occurring during live clone

1. Snapshot of existing VM to minimize downtime

2. Detect if VM is PV or HVM and flag accordingly

3. Copy snapshot to NFS SR to collapse snapshot chain

4. Connect primary network to HIMN to ensure no machine collision

5. Use VNC to reconfigure network and connect to XenServer DHCP

6. Copy and run cleanse scripts which shutdown clone when complete

7. Detect shutdown and run Provisioners

8. Export and import into CloudStack as template
